Manoeuvring in shallow waters with a bow thruster remote control - Practical Boat Owner

Andrew Morton explains how a bow thruster remote control helped him manoeuvre safely alongside a new jetty in potentially shallow water. Millport jetty is accessible at high tide. Photo: Andrew Morton. Up until I found myself manoeuvring in close, shallow waters, I had gave little consideration to the advantages of having a bow thruster remote control.
